At the World Cup in Qatar, female referees will referee games for the first time.
Stephanie Frappart, Salima Mukansanga and Yoshimi Yamashita officiate in Qatar.
Doha – This has never happened before: Female referees are used for the first time in World Cup history.
FIFA nominated Stephanie Frappart, Salima Mukansanga and Yoshimi Yamashita for the finals of the 2022 World Cup in Qatar.
The premiere is taking place in the Gulf State of all places, where women are massively discriminated against.
They were not used in the first week of the tournament (schedule for the 2022 World Cup).
Who are the three women anyway?
Three female referees at the World Cup: Frappart, Mukansanga and Yamashita ensure something new
France's Stephanie Frappart is by far the best known to European football audiences.
The 38-year-old is used to making history: in 2019 she became the first woman to officiate a major international competitive game, the UEFA Supercup between Chelsea FC and Liverpool FC.
In 2020 she was the first referee to referee a Champions League game.
Salima Mukansanga comes from Rwanda and also has experience in men's football.
She is a trained nurse and midwife and earlier this year became the first woman to officiate a game at the Africa Cup of Nations.

World Cup 2022: Referee Yamashita between man and machine
The third in the group of referees is Yoshimi Yamashita.
The 38-year-old has eclipsed her male counterparts - she is the only referee from Japan at the World Cup.
She wants to "apply the rules like a machine" and "communicate her decisions as humanly as possible," she recently explained.

In addition to the three main referees, three other linesmen are used: Neuza Back (Brazil), Karen Diaz Medina (Mexico) and Kathryn Nesbitt (USA).
Incidentally, the only German referee at the World Cup is Daniel Siebert.
